Volvo's luxury EV brand, Pole Star, is the first plug-in hybrid vehicle. A premium sports car with a high-output engine and high-output motor, which is produced with only 1,500 units.

Toyota's flagship minivan. The luxury minivan that sells like hotcakes has undergone a full model change for the first time in eight years. In terms of design, it's the same as the previous one, so people other than car enthusiasts might not be able to tell the difference. However, the running performance has improved significantly, and the lack of rigidity in the large body has been alleviated to a large extent, resulting in a firmer ride.
